The Chess King Triomphe is the French version of the Chess King Master, but like all Chess Kings it was made in England. There are a number of differences between the Triomphe and the Master. Immediately you notice that the key layouts are different. The Triomphe also has a Hitachi 6301V processor running at 4MHz compared with the Master’s Z80 running at 8MHz. The Triomphe probably has a Mark Taylor program, although a reworked version of the Kaare Danielsen 4K program is another, if controversial, possibility. The Master has a version of Richard Lang’s Cyrus program.
This Triomphe was actually found in Spain. They seem to be present in few collections, and appear rarely on Ebay.
